LETTER #15 (January)
Dear Secret Sister,
Darla, Sarah, and I spent New Yearâs Eve the same way we spent Christmas eve. In Miss Andersonâs room, having our own little party. The other two girls didnât show up, which was more than fine with us. Although I think Miss Anderson was a little disappointed.
But she seemed to have a wonderful time as we talked about books, and writing, and plants, and ideas.
I have made a New Yearâs resolution that I will write more. My goal is to fill my blue journal with all sorts of stories and poetry. I will keep my grades up, of course. But I feel inspired to write.
I already have some short stories tucked in there, scrawled on loose-leaf papers. I tried to practice writing neatly, but once the story gets started, itâs hard for my hand to keep up with my brain. Writing free-hand is so much different than writing on my computer. But I am loving every minute of it.
We were discussing possible resolutions when I mentioned my goal to the group. Miss Anderson said that if I wanted a real challenge, I could turn in a story to her every Monday. I seem to work better with deadlines, so I agreed to the challenge. And I already have my first story to turn in when Monday comes.
The four of us stayed up until midnight, telling stories and reading to one another. We each chose some of our favorite books and read passages out of them that showed why it was one of our favorites.
As we read, I discovered that Sarah likes science fiction, which I never would have guessed. Miss Anderson likes Regency romances and Gothic horror. And I already knew that Darla had a penchant for dark fantasy and urban fantasy. But I think what a person reads tells a lot about them to a certain degree.
I also discovered that Sarah wants to try her hand at writing science fiction, instead of the fantasy world that we had been creating. She even had a story to read out loud to us that evening. It was really good. So good in fact, I asked to borrow a few of her science fiction books. She may have me hooked on the genre!
After midnight struck, we all read one last favorite passage and then Miss Anderson sent us off to bed. She wanted us to get back to a regular sleep schedule before classes started in a few days.
We went back to Darlaâs and my room and read to one another until dawn. What Miss Anderson didnât know wouldnât hurt her.
Sarah moved back into her room on the morning of the second. All of the students started filing back to school to be ready for classes on the third.
Our crowded room felt empty without Sarah camped out on the floor anymore. Darla and I both missed her. And we could both tell that she was reluctant to return to her own room to wait for Freda to return from her winter break.
